Big Will,

David Hafler was an engineer who designed some classic components in the '60s and early '70s--the Dyna stereo power amps, tube and solid state. He left Dyna and started Hafler, which never really flourished. I'd be wary of SS gear that old. .

Historical note: Hafler kick-started the trend to surround sound by developing the "Hafler" surround scheme. If memory serves he incorporated it into some of the Dyna preamps. Everyone I knew tried out the Hafler circuit and the demo LP (vinyl) of choice was Joni Mitchell's Miles of Aisles. It decoded really well and pushed all the applause to the rear channel.
